Patent number: 11179297
Abstract: Metal-containing methacrylates incorporated into polymeric materials with antimicrobial capacity for biomedical applications, and more particularly for dental purposes, are provided. The incorporation of metal-containing methacrylates such as calcium methacrylate, tin methacrylate, copper methacrylate, silver methacrylate, in combination or alone, for potentializing antimicrobial effect of cements, in particular, to biomaterial compositions including metal containing methacrylates, such as calcium, tin, copper, silver, nickel, titanium and iron methacrylates, in the formulation of biomaterials for applications in human health provides advantages, particularly in dentistry, and allows for expressive antimicrobial activity to dental compositions, so as to be useful in dental prosthesis, operative dentistry, orthodontics, pediatric dentistry, implantodontics, and endodontics.
